    Default ? about bag sales at your thrift stores

    How big of a bag do your thrift stores give you for a bag sale? Do your stores allow you to include anything from the store in the bag or specific items only?

    There is only one thrift store here that does bag sales and you never know when they're going to run one. A couple of years ago the bag they gave was a huge paper bag about 3 feet tall (seriously!). Then about a year ago they reduced the size to a regular brown paper grocery bag. A few months ago they reduced the size further and it's now a regular plastic grocery bag.

    As for what is included in the bag sale, here it's clothing items only - no purses, no shoes, no belts, no prom dresses or other clothing items they have deemed 'special', no leather jackets or other leather items, no toys, no books, no games, etc.

    The store here charges $3 per bag.
